Position Summary
Senior Workers’ Compensation Claims Specialist will service our multi-state clients’ workers’ compensation claims with little to no supervision required. This role requires that the claims specialist monitor their assigned employers’ workers’ compensation claims, from inception through closure, to ensure that all salient aspects of claim adjudication are being effectively and efficiently performed. This position will also be the main point of contact for client education on general work comp matters.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Lead comprehensive investigations of complex workers’ compensation claims, including in‑depth coverage analysis, compensability determinations, medical review, witness statements, and employer documentation, and provide detailed findings and strategic recommendations to the third‑party administrator (TPA) adjuster.
Evaluate and respond to TPA requests for reserve and settlement authority, conducting advanced exposure assessments based on medical prognosis, statutory benefits, vocational factors, litigation risk, and historical claim patterns to ensure appropriately set reserves and fiscally sound settlement decisions.
Perform sophisticated claim evaluations to determine potential financial and operational exposure, identifying high‑risk factors, potential red flags, subrogation opportunities, and long‑term cost drivers, and advising clients on proactive strategies to mitigate future loss.
Serve as a high‑level consultant to clients on risk mitigation, analyzing claim trends, identifying systemic issues, recommending safety improvements, and developing strategies that reduce workplace injuries and claim frequency. · Provide empathetic and expert‑level communication to injured workers by offering clear guidance, answering complex questions, supporting their understanding of the claims process, and acting as a knowledgeable, compassionate advocate while balancing employer interests.
Support clients in developing and optimizing return‑to‑work (RTW) programs, including identifying alternative/light‑duty assignments, evaluating functional capacity, and advising on transitional work opportunities to accelerate recovery and reduce indemnity costs.
Act as a strategic liaison between clients, TPA adjusters, defense counsel, medical providers, and injured employees, ensuring coordinated case management, clear communication pathways, and reduced litigation exposure through early intervention and proactive engagement.
Continuously monitor claim progression, ensuring timely action on medical updates, legal developments, benefit delivery, adjuster activity, and compliance with jurisdictional requirements, while identifying delays or inaccuracies that require escalation.
Manage a portfolio of complex workers’ compensation claims from initial filing through closure, directing claim strategies, driving timely resolution, ensuring accurate documentation, and influencing case outcomes through expert guidance and oversight.
Identify process improvements, leveraging data, claim trends, and client feedback to enhance the effectiveness of the workers’ compensation program and improve overall claim outcomes.
Mentor and support junior claims staff, sharing expertise, offering case guidance, and contributing to the development of best‑practice procedures across the claims team.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
In‑depth knowledge of workers’ compensation laws, statutes, and regulations across multiple jurisdictions, with the ability to interpret complex legal and medical documentation.
Expert understanding of claims investigation techniques, compensability analysis, coverage verification, and advanced risk assessment.
Extensive knowledge of medical terminology, treatment guidelines, return‑to‑work principles, and rehabilitation processes to evaluate claim progression and exposure.
Strong understanding of litigation processes, including legal strategy, attorney management, settlement negotiation, legal bill review, and mediation practices.
Advanced knowledge of reserve setting and financial exposure analysis, including actuarial impacts, trend evaluation, and loss forecasting.
Exceptional analytical and critical‑thinking skills, capable of interpreting complex claim data, identifying red flags, and developing sophisticated mitigation strategies.
High‑level communication and interpersonal skills, including the ability to explain complex workers’ compensation concepts clearly to clients, executives, and injured employees.
Strong negotiation skills, including settlement evaluation, dispute resolution, and strategic communication with attorneys and adjusters.
Advanced case‑management and organizational skills, with the ability to manage a high‑volume or high‑complexity caseload while ensuring accuracy, compliance, and timely action.
Proficiency in claims software, medical management systems, and data tools, including advanced Excel skills for reporting, trend analysis, and reserve reviews.
Expert documentation and reporting skills, including the ability to prepare high‑quality claim summaries, risk analyses, and client advisories.
Strong client‑relationship and consultative skills, supporting program development, training, and strategic risk reduction.
